I think it's more of a mental thing than anything else. We might spend about $2K in food for a week. If we compare the exchange now vs a few months ago when our dollar was in the low 80s, a 5 cent difference only amounts to $100 more. I understand that every lit bit counts, as a Disney vacation is not cheap, but for most people, I would think if you can afford to go to Disney, an extra $3-400 is not going to be a deal breaker. Skip a dessert party or do quick service 2-3 times instead of table service and you have pretty much made up the difference.
